Form 4: CCC Intelligent Solutions Executive Exercises and Sells Stock Options

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4


A CCC Intelligent Solutions executive exercised stock options and sold the resulting shares under a pre-arranged trading plan.

Summary

  • Rodney Christo, Chief Accounting Officer of CCC Intelligent Solutions Holdings Inc., exercised 75,000 stock options at a price of $2.50 per share on November 20, 2024.
  • The same day, Mr. Christo sold 75,000 shares of common stock at a weighted average price of $12.0115 per share.
  • These transactions were execut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an adopted on August 16, 2024.
  • Following these transactions, Mr. Christo directly owns no common stock and indirectly owns 135,642 shares through a trust.
  • Mr. Christo also holds 20,275 stock options.

Industry Context

This is a routine filing related to executive compensation and trading activity, which is common in publicly traded companies. The use of a 10b5-1 plan is a standard practice to avoid accusations of insider trading.

Key Dates

DateDescription
07/30/2021Date of the merger between CCC Intelligent Solutions Holdings Inc. and Cypress Holdings, Inc., where the stock options were initially granted.
08/16/2024Date the Rule 10b5-1 trading plan was adopted by the reporting person.
11/20/2024Date of the stock option exercise and subsequent sale of shares.
11/22/2024Date the SEC Form 4 was signed.
